1. Understanding the Basics: Zelle and Cash App
Zelle and Cash App are popular digital payment platforms, but they operate differently. To understand How To Transfer Money From Cash App To Zelle, let’s break down their core functionalities:
1.1 What is Zelle?
Zelle is a digital payment network that allows users to send and receive money directly between bank accounts within the United States. It is often integrated into banking apps, providing a seamless way to transfer funds to friends, family, and trusted individuals.
- Key Features:
- Direct Bank Transfers: Zelle facilitates transfers directly between bank accounts.
- No Separate Account: Users typically access Zelle through their existing bank account, meaning no need to create a new account.
- Fast Transfers: Transfers are generally processed within minutes.
- Widely Accepted: Many banks and credit unions across the U.S. support Zelle.
- How it Works:
- Enrollment: Users enroll in Zelle through their bank’s online banking platform or the Zelle app.
- Recipient Selection: To send money, users select a recipient from their contacts or enter their email address or U.S. mobile phone number.
- Transaction: The funds are transferred directly from the sender’s bank account to the recipient’s bank account.

1.2 What is Cash App?
Cash App is a mobile payment service developed by Block, Inc. (formerly Square, Inc.) that allows users to send and receive money through a mobile app. It also offers additional features such as investing, Bitcoin transactions, and a debit card.
- Key Features:
- Mobile App: All transactions are done through the Cash App mobile application.
- Cash App Balance: Users can store money in their Cash App balance.
- Cash Card: A customizable debit card linked to the Cash App balance.
- Investing: Users can buy stocks and Bitcoin through the app.
- How it Works:
- Account Creation: Users download the Cash App and create an account.
- Linking Accounts: Users can link their bank accounts and debit cards to fund their Cash App balance or make payments.
- Transactions: Money can be sent to other Cash App users via their username ($Cashtag), phone number, or email address.
- Cash Card Usage: Users can use their Cash Card to make purchases online or in-store, drawing funds directly from their Cash App balance.
1.3 Key Differences
The primary difference lies in how these platforms handle money transfers:
- Zelle: Transfers money directly between bank accounts.
- Cash App: Transfers money within the Cash App ecosystem, utilizing a Cash App balance.
2. Direct Transfer Limitations
Unfortunately, there is no direct way to transfer money from Cash App to Zelle due to their different operational frameworks. Zelle is designed for direct bank-to-bank transfers, while Cash App operates as a closed-loop system with its own stored balance.
3. Workaround: Using a Bank Account as an Intermediary
To move funds from Cash App to Zelle, you must use a bank account as an intermediary. Here’s a step-by-step guide:
3.1 Step 1: Transfer Funds from Cash App to Your Bank Account
The first step is to transfer the money from your Cash App balance to your linked bank account.
- Open Cash App: Launch the Cash App on your mobile device.
- Navigate to the Banking Tab: Tap the “Banking” tab (house icon) on the bottom left corner of the screen.
- Select “Cash Out”: Choose the “Cash Out” option.
- Enter the Amount: Input the amount you wish to transfer to your bank account.
Cash App Cash Out
- Choose Transfer Speed:
- Standard Transfer: This option is typically free and takes 1-3 business days.
- Instant Transfer: This option incurs a fee (usually 0.5% to 1.75% of the transfer amount) but delivers the money to your bank account almost immediately.
- Confirm Your Bank Account: Ensure your linked bank account is correctly selected.
- Initiate the Transfer: Confirm the transaction and wait for the funds to be deposited into your bank account.
3.2 Step 2: Send Money from Your Bank Account via Zelle
Once the funds are in your bank account, you can use Zelle to send the money to the intended recipient.
- Access Zelle: Log in to your bank’s online banking platform or open the Zelle app if your bank offers it separately.
- Select Recipient: Choose the recipient from your contacts or enter their email address or U.S. mobile phone number.
- Enter Amount: Input the amount you wish to send.
Zelle interface
- Review Details: Double-check the recipient’s information and the amount to ensure accuracy.
- Send Money: Confirm the transaction. The money will be transferred directly from your bank account to the recipient’s bank account.
4. Fees and Transfer Times
Understanding the fees and transfer times associated with each step is crucial for efficient money management.
4.1 Cash App Fees and Transfer Times
- Standard Transfer: Free, takes 1-3 business days.
- Instant Transfer: 0.5% to 1.75% fee, almost immediate.
- Credit Card Transfers: 3% fee (not applicable in this scenario, as you’re transferring out of Cash App).
4.2 Zelle Fees and Transfer Times
- Fees: Zelle typically does not charge fees for sending or receiving money. However, it’s advisable to check with your bank, as some financial institutions may have their own fee structures.
- Transfer Times: Transfers are usually processed within minutes.
5. Security Considerations
When transferring money between platforms, security should be a top priority.
5.1 Cash App Security Tips
- Enable Security Lock: Use a PIN or biometric authentication to secure your Cash App.
- Be Cautious of Scams: Only send money to people you know and trust.
- Monitor Transactions: Regularly review your transaction history for any unauthorized activity.
5.2 Zelle Security Tips
- Verify Recipient Details: Always double-check the recipient’s email address or phone number before sending money.
- Beware of Phishing: Be cautious of suspicious emails or messages asking for your Zelle login information.
- Use Secure Networks: Avoid using public Wi-Fi when making transactions.
5.3 General Security Practices
- Strong Passwords: Use strong, unique passwords for your Cash App, bank account, and email accounts.
- Two-Factor Authentication: Enable two-factor authentication whenever available for added security.
- Regularly Update Apps: Keep your Cash App, banking app, and mobile device operating system up to date to protect against vulnerabilities.
6. Limitations and Alternatives
6.1 Transfer Limits
Both Cash App and Zelle have transfer limits that may affect your ability to move large sums of money.
- Cash App Limits:
- Unverified Accounts: Can send up to $250 per week and receive up to $1,000 per month.
- Verified Accounts: Have higher limits. To verify your account, you typically need to provide your full name, date of birth, and the last four digits of your Social Security number.
- Zelle Limits:
- Zelle transfer limits depend on your bank. Some banks may have daily or weekly limits, while others have per-transaction limits. For instance, Wells Fargo has a daily limit of $2,500, while other banks may allow up to $3,500 per day.

7. Troubleshooting Common Issues
Even with careful planning, you may encounter issues when transferring money between Cash App and Zelle. Here are some common problems and how to resolve them:
7.1 Transfer Delays
- Issue: Money does not appear in your bank account or the recipient’s account within the expected timeframe.
- Solution:
- Check Account Details: Ensure that all account details, such as bank account numbers and routing numbers, are correct.
- Verify Transfer Status: Check the transfer status on both Cash App and your bank’s online banking platform.
- Contact Customer Support: If the delay persists, contact Cash App support and your bank’s customer service for assistance.
7.2 Failed Transfers
- Issue: The transfer fails to go through.
- Solution:
- Insufficient Funds: Make sure you have sufficient funds in your Cash App balance or bank account.
- Account Restrictions: Check for any restrictions on your Cash App or bank account that may be preventing the transfer.
- Technical Issues: There may be temporary technical issues with the Cash App or your bank’s systems. Try again later or contact customer support.
7.3 Account Verification Problems
- Issue: Difficulty verifying your Cash App or Zelle account.
- Solution:
- Provide Accurate Information: Ensure that the information you provide for verification, such as your name, date of birth, and Social Security number, is accurate and matches your bank records.
- Contact Support: If you continue to experience verification issues, contact Cash App or Zelle support for guidance.

11. FAQs: Transferring Money from Cash App to Zelle
11.1 Can I directly transfer money from Cash App to Zelle?
No, you cannot directly transfer money from Cash App to Zelle. You must first transfer the funds from Cash App to your linked bank account and then use Zelle to send the money to the recipient’s bank account.
11.2 What are the steps to transfer money from Cash App to Zelle?
The steps are:
- Transfer funds from your Cash App balance to your linked bank account.
- Wait for the funds to appear in your bank account.
- Use Zelle to send the money from your bank account to the recipient.
11.3 Are there any fees for transferring money between Cash App and Zelle?
- Cash App charges fees for instant transfers (0.5% to 1.75%). Standard transfers are free but take 1-3 business days.
- Zelle typically does not charge fees, but check with your bank to confirm.
11.4 How long does it take to transfer money from Cash App to Zelle?
The transfer time depends on the method you choose:
- Cash App standard transfer: 1-3 business days.
- Cash App instant transfer: Almost immediate (fee applies).
- Zelle transfer: Usually within minutes.
11.5 Is it safe to transfer money from Cash App to Zelle?
Yes, it is generally safe if you follow security best practices:
- Verify recipient details.
- Use strong passwords.
- Enable two-factor authentication.
- Be cautious of scams.
11.6 What are the transfer limits for Cash App and Zelle?
- Cash App: Unverified accounts have lower limits ($250 per week sending, $1,000 per month receiving). Verified accounts have higher limits.
- Zelle: Limits vary by bank. Check with your bank for specific limits.
11.7 Why is my transfer from Cash App to Zelle delayed?
Delays can occur due to:
- Incorrect account details.
- Insufficient funds.
- Technical issues with Cash App or your bank.
- Account restrictions.
11.8 Can I cancel a transfer from Cash App to Zelle?
You can cancel a Cash App transfer if it is still pending. Once the transfer is complete and the funds have been sent, you cannot cancel it. Zelle transfers are also typically immediate and cannot be canceled once sent.
11.9 What should I do if I accidentally send money to the wrong person?
- Contact Cash App or Zelle support immediately.
- Ask the recipient to return the money.
- If the recipient refuses, contact your bank for assistance.
11.10 Can I use a credit card to transfer money from Cash App to Zelle?
You can use a credit card to send money via Cash App, but this incurs a 3% fee. However, Zelle does not allow transfers using credit cards.
